How the Rural Drone Racing League Works
The league involves multiple regional tournaments leading up to a national championship. Teams of students, often representing their schools or local youth clubs, compete in obstacle-filled aerial courses. Each race demands precision piloting, quick thinking, and an understanding of drone mechanics. In Rural STEM Sports, this combination of physical skill and mental sharpness sets a new standard for extracurricular activities in underserved areas.
To ensure inclusivity, organizers are partnering with rural schools to provide training sessions and drone kits at subsidized rates. The aim is to make South Africa Drone Racing 2025 accessible even to students who have never handled advanced technology before.

Economic and Educational Impact
The most impressive aspect of Rural STEM Sports is its potential for long-term change. Students who participate in South Africa Drone Racing 2025 gain valuable technical skills, from coding flight paths to maintaining drone batteries. These are directly transferable to real-world industries such as agriculture, surveying, and disaster management. Rural communities, often left out of the tech revolution, now have a gateway to future-ready employment.
The program also encourages gender diversity. More girls are joining the racing teams, supported by mentorship initiatives that highlight female role models in tech and engineering. This not only challenges stereotypes but also ensures a broader talent pool in South Africa’s growing tech sector.
Comparison of Rural vs. Urban Participation
Below is a snapshot comparing participation trends between rural and urban areas in the 2025 season of South Africa Drone Racing 2025:
Area Type | Avg. Teams per Region | Female Participation (%) | Access to Training Hubs |
---|---|---|---|
Rural | 18 | 42% | 60% |
Urban | 25 | 38% | 85% |
The table shows that while rural areas have slightly fewer teams, female participation is higher—thanks to targeted outreach by Rural STEM Sports organizers.
